Luo et al [8] designed a grinding wheel with ordered micro-abrasives; to make this grinding wheel, a lithography mask was used in composite electroforming, and they further studied the wear and grinding characteristics of the designed grinding wheel in grinding silicon wafer materials. Mao et al [9] used a laser to create micro spiral grooves on the working surface of a grinding wheel, filled the grooves with epoxy resin, and electroplated the grinding wheel with orderly arranged abrasive spirals.…”
